One of the most critical components of bringing a medical device to market is navigating the regulatory pathway set forth by the appropriate governing bodies, such as the Food and Drug Administration (FDA) in the United States. The regulatory process is designed to ensure that medical devices are safe and effective for their intended use and that appropriate quality standards are met. Manufacturers must demonstrate through extensive testing and data collection that their device meets these requirements before it can be approved for commercialization.
The regulatory pathway for medical devices can vary depending on the classification of the device and the level of risk that it poses to patients. Class I devices, such as tongue depressors and bandages, are considered low risk and typically require only general controls to ensure safety and effectiveness. Class II devices, such as infusion pumps and surgical drapes, are higher risk and require specific performance standards and post-market surveillance. Class III devices, such as implantable devices and life-supporting equipment, are the highest risk category and require the most stringent regulatory controls.
In addition to regulatory requirements, manufacturers must also consider reimbursement and market access strategies when bringing a medical device to market. Healthcare payers, such as insurance companies and government agencies, play a critical role in determining whether a device will be covered and reimbursed for use by patients. Manufacturers must demonstrate the clinical and economic value of their device to these stakeholders in order to secure reimbursement and achieve widespread adoption in the market.
